Introduction
In the rapidly evolving field of education, program evaluation is an essential skill for ensuring accountability, enhancing learning outcomes, and optimizing resource allocation. Training Course on Program Evaluation in Education is designed for educators, administrators, researchers, and policy-makers who aim to master data-driven decision-making and evidence-based educational planning. Through an in-depth exploration of both qualitative and quantitative evaluation methods, participants will gain the tools to assess program effectiveness, measure learning impact, and drive continuous improvement.
Built on modern trends such as data literacy, impact assessment, stakeholder engagement, and equity-centered evaluation, this course integrates real-world case studies with practical exercises. Participants will explore how to align evaluation designs with program goals, analyze findings through various tools, and communicate results effectively to influence policy and practice. By the end, learners will be equipped to lead transformative educational evaluations and drive systemic change.

Course Modules
Module 1: Introduction to Program Evaluation in Education
- Define key evaluation terms and concepts
- Identify the purpose and scope of educational evaluation
- Explore types of evaluation: formative, summative, developmental
- Understand evaluation standards and ethics
- Recognize common challenges in program evaluation
- Case Study: Evaluating a national literacy initiative
Module 2: Developing Logic Models
- Understand components of logic models
- Link goals, inputs, activities, outputs, outcomes
- Align logic models with program design
- Use logic models for planning and evaluation
- Engage stakeholders in model development
- Case Study: Using logic models in teacher training programs
Module 3: Evaluation Design and Planning
- Choose appropriate evaluation designs (experimental, quasi, non-experimental)
- Align evaluation questions with design
- Plan timelines and resource allocations
- Address potential threats to validity
- Develop evaluation proposals
- Case Study: Evaluation plan for STEM curriculum integration
Module 4: Data Collection Methods
- Select between qualitative vs. quantitative methods
- Develop effective surveys, interview guides, observation tools
- Understand sampling techniques
- Ensure reliability and validity
- Use technology to streamline data collection
- Case Study: Mixed-methods data collection in school improvement project
Module 5: Quantitative Data Analysis
- Use descriptive and inferential statistics
- Employ tools like Excel, SPSS, R
- Interpret test scores and achievement metrics
- Visualize data using dashboards
- Identify trends and correlations
- Case Study: Statistical analysis of standardized test interventions
Module 6: Qualitative Data Analysis
- Code data from interviews, focus groups, and narratives
- Identify themes and patterns
- Use software (e.g., NVivo, MAXQDA)
- Ensure trustworthiness (credibility, transferability)
- Present qualitative findings meaningfully
- Case Study: Thematic analysis of educator feedback
Module 7: Stakeholder Engagement
- Identify key internal and external stakeholders
- Design stakeholder communication plans
- Collect stakeholder feedback systematically
- Navigate conflicting interests
- Enhance buy-in through transparency
- Case Study: Engaging community in curriculum evaluation
Module 8: Formative and Summative Evaluation
- Differentiate formative vs. summative evaluation
- Apply each in appropriate contexts
- Use feedback to improve ongoing programs
- Measure long-term impact at program end
- Balance multiple data sources
- Case Study: Dual evaluation of digital learning rollout
Module 9: Impact Evaluation
- Understand impact vs. outcome measures
- Use counterfactual reasoning
- Implement randomized control trials (RCTs)
- Assess unintended effects
- Calculate effect sizes
- Case Study: Measuring long-term literacy gains post-intervention
Module 10: Evaluation Reporting and Communication
- Choose the right format for your audience
- Use storytelling and visuals to communicate data
- Write executive summaries and full reports
- Present findings to decision-makers
- Ensure accessibility and inclusivity
- Case Study: Reporting evaluation of early childhood programs
Module 11: Ethics in Educational Evaluation
- Review ethical principles in research and evaluation
- Obtain informed consent
- Address privacy and confidentiality
- Manage power dynamics
- Apply culturally responsive approaches
- Case Study: Ethics in evaluating programs for marginalized learners
Module 12: Technology and Digital Tools in Evaluation
- Explore digital data collection tools (e.g., Google Forms, SurveyMonkey)
- Use learning analytics platforms
- Implement cloud-based reporting tools
- Automate data analysis
- Monitor data quality in real time
- Case Study: Tech-enabled evaluation in remote learning
Module 13: Cost-Effectiveness and ROI Evaluation
- Define cost-effectiveness in education
- Conduct cost-benefit analysis
- Evaluate program sustainability
- Integrate financial metrics into logic models
- Use budgeting tools
- Case Study: Cost analysis of after-school programs
Module 14: Culturally Responsive and Equitable Evaluation
- Assess equity gaps in educational programs
- Apply inclusive frameworks
- Center marginalized voices in evaluations
- Tailor tools to diverse contexts
- Use equity-focused rubrics
- Case Study: Evaluating inclusive practices in special education
Module 15: Evaluation for Continuous Improvement
- Align findings with strategic planning
- Embed evaluation into organizational learning
- Use feedback loops
- Develop improvement action plans
- Build a culture of reflection and data use
- Case Study: School-wide improvement cycle driven by evaluation
